Vintage Bike Show

Calling all vintage bike lovers! Join us for the Retro Ride & Vintage Bike Show on Saturday, August 10th at the Kulshan Roosevelt Taproom (K2) from 1–4 PM! Whether it’s a vintage mountain bike, classic roadie, or a one-of-a-kind garage build, bring your ride and show it off! 

The event is free to enter, just make sure to pre-register. The only qualification is that your bike is pre-2000(ish). We'll have prizes for the top three builds! To kick things off, join the informal pre-show ride at 11 AM. Road riders will meet at K2, while the mountain bike crew will start at the Birch Street trailhead.

        We acknowledge that Whatcom County is located on the unceded territory of the Coast Salish Peoples. They cared for the lands that included what we’d call the Puget Sound region, Vancouver Island and British Columbia since time immemorial. This gives us the great obligation and opportunity to learn how to care for our surrounding areas and all the natural and human resources we require to live. We express our deepest respect and gratitude for our indigenous neighbors, the Lummi Nation and Nooksack Tribe, for their enduring care and protection of our shared lands and waterways.
